Anti-Infective Agents Market Predicted to Attain US$ 195.8 Billion Mark, Driven by Strong CAGR
The anti-infective agents market is expected to achieve a value of US$ 141 billion in fiscal year 2022, indicating a rise from the previous fiscal year's value of US$ 136 billion. From 2022 to 2032, the market is predicted to demonstrate a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.3%, ultimately reaching a value of US$ 195.8 billion by the end of 2032. This market holds significant importance within the pharmaceutical industry as it plays a crucial role in preventing and treating infectious diseases. It encompasses a wide range of drugs, including antibiotics, antivirals, antifungals, and antiparasitic drugs. The market has experienced consistent growth over the years due to the increasing prevalence of infectious diseases, emergence of new infectious agents, and the continuous development of drug-resistant strains.

Market Dynamics:
The market dynamics of anti-infective agents are shaped by a complex interplay of factors. The increasing prevalence of infectious diseases, fueled by factors like population growth, urbanization, and global travel, is a primary driver of market expansion. Additionally, the continual evolution of pathogens and the emergence of drug-resistant strains pose challenges, necessitating the development of innovative anti-infective solutions.
Market Future Outlook:
The future outlook of the anti-infective agents market remains promising, with an anticipated trajectory of sustained growth. Technological advancements, particularly in genomics and immunology, are expected to drive the development of targeted therapies and personalized medicine, revolutionizing the treatment of infectious diseases. The market is likely to witness increased collaboration between pharmaceutical companies and research institutions to accelerate the discovery and development of new anti-infective agents.
Market Insights:
The anti-infective agents market is characterized by a diverse portfolio of products, including antibiotics, antivirals, antifungals, and antiparasitic drugs. The demand for broad-spectrum antibiotics and combination therapies is on the rise, reflecting the need for versatile solutions against a wide range of pathogens. Additionally, the market is witnessing a shift towards the development of alternatives to traditional antibiotics, such as phage therapy and immunotherapies.

Competitive Landscape:
The United States Food and Drug Administration (USFDA) has granted Alembic Pharmaceuticals final clearance for its investigational new drug application (ANDA) for Doxycycline Hyclate Delayed-Release Tablets in January 2022. The purpose of Doxycycline Hyclate Delayed-Release Tablets is to inhibit the growth of antibiotic-resistant germs.
In April 2022, Novartis announced the implementation of a new organizational structure and operating model. These changes are designed to support the company's goals of fostering innovation, development, and productivity as a focused pharmaceuticals company over the next decade.
In January 2022, Savior Mankind, a division of Mankind Pharma dedicated to life-saving injectables, was introduced. Its product portfolio includes medications for anti-infectives, stroke, and trauma therapy. By developing, manufacturing, commercializing, and providing affordable and accessible medications that address patients' immediate medical needs, Mankind Pharma aims to contribute to the community's overall well-being.
